Why You Need a Dedicated BMS Module

Lithium-ion cells possess incredible energy density but are highly sensitive to voltage extremes. Our protection board actively monitors your 3.7V cell. If the voltage spikes dangerously high during charging or drops too low under heavy load, the board instantly severs the connection. This critical intervention prevents irreversible cell chemistry damage, swelling, overheating, and potential fire hazards, giving your hardware enterprise-grade stability.

Technical Specifications

  • Cell Configuration: 1S (Single Cell)
  • Compatible Batteries: 18650 Lithium-Ion / 3.7V LiPo
  • Working Current (Upper Limit): 10A
  • Peak/Overcurrent Detection: 12A
  • Overcharge Detection Voltage: 4.25V ±0.05V
  • Overcharge Release Voltage: 4.23V ±0.05V
  • Standard Charging Voltage: 4.2V
  • Dimensions: 35mm x 7.4mm x 2.2mm

FAQ Section

Q. Can I use this BMS for a 2S or 3S series battery pack?
A. No, this is a 1S (Single Cell) protection board designed strictly for a single 3.7V cell or multiple cells wired in parallel. For series connections that increase voltage, you must use a dedicated 2S or 3S BMS.

Q. Do I need a special charger if I use this board?
A. Yes, you still need a dedicated 4.2V lithium-ion battery charger. The BMS protects the battery from catastrophic overcharging, but it is a safety net, not a primary charging controller.

Q. Is this module compatible with flat Lithium Polymer (LiPo) cells?
A. Yes! As long as your LiPo battery has a nominal voltage of 3.7V and a maximum charge voltage of 4.2V, this protection board will work perfectly.
